Cap Laser Welding Machine is used for laser welding between the top cover and the shell of the power battery, to achieve the sealing between the top cover and the shell. The main functions include: battery scanning code, positioning of the battery into the fixture, laser defocus detection and welding, welding quality detection, flanging roll, welding splash and dust absorption treatment, battery material and bad discharge.
